Disney Dreamlight Valley update 5 release date & time
If you can't wait any longer for the next Disney Dreamlight Valley update, you're in luck, as the 5th update, titled 'The Remembering' will arrive on June 9, 2023, at 6AM PT / 9AM ET / 2PM BST.

What is in the next Disney Dreamlight Valley update?
On May 30, 2023, Disney Dreamlight Valley's Twitter account detailed that the next update will include their "biggest story update yet" and will see players uncovering secrets from The Remembering.
Alongside these details, an accompanying image shows a player character standing beside the Fairy Godmother from Cinderella, with the mysterious Pumpkin house of the Forgotten Valley off to the side (will we finally learn who lives there?), plus a mysterious, never before seen treehouse!
A day prior on May 29, 2023, Gameloft also shared that players will be able to place multiple player homes throughout their Valley, with a video showcasing the default player home alongside skins which can be purchased in the Premium Shop:
New items are also said to be arriving, with what looks to be the Fairy Godmother's wand shown placed on a bench that looks strikingly similar to the one Cinderella cries on from the eponymous 1950 animated movie.
Umbrellas are also making their way into the Valley, though details on whether these serve simply as accessories or if there's an added purpose to them are currently unclear.
In the most recent roadmap that Gameloft shared in a news post on 31 May 2023, Disney Dreamlight Valley's fifth update is also set to bring a "Touch of Magic" with furniture and mannequins, lining up with a previous Tweet that showcased different saved outfits displayed on mannequins that players can then wear.
Additionally, this ties in with another Tweet, sharing that players will be able to add a "personal Touch" to the valley with a new addition, pointing at the option to edit the appearance of furniture items.
Many of these details were confirmed on June 6, 2023, when Gameloft revealed a story and update trailer for the 5th update alongside the confirmation of the release date.
Disney Dreamlight Valley 2023 roadmap details
Looking ahead to the rest of 2023 outside of the fifth update, there's plenty to get excited for - from the images in the roadmap alone, we can see Princess Vanellope from Wreck-It Ralph, Belle from Beauty and The Beast, and an hourglass in the sand.
Whether these characters will be companions like Prince Eric and Anna remain to be seen, but it's still undoubtedly very exciting for players - especially as Belle has been shown on key art since Disney Dreamlight Valley went into early access.
We can also see what to expect in Disney Dreamlight Valley's upcoming Star Paths, celebrating D100 and Pixar, with the roadmap showing icons relating to Turning Red, Dory from Finding Nemo, and Inside Out. Later in the year, another Star Path has been teased, with 'darkness' set to re-appear as a theme.
Additional content set to be arriving throughout the year following update five are:
- Summer Update: A new villager, and a feature to win in-game prizes
- September: A new realm and new friends
- Late 2023: New characters, new 'Frontiers', a new Royal Tool, Multiplayer, and more
What is the next Star Path?
While it's unconfirmed as to precisely when the next Star Path will appear in Dreamlight Valley, on June 5, 2023, the previously-teased Pixar Star-Path was shown off further in an additional Tweet from Gameloft, detailing the 'Wonder of Pixar' themed pass and that it will arrive "very soon":
This image shows off everything from characters in a Turning Red-themed onesie and statues of pandas, to a fish tank, an alternative look for Buzz Lightyear, and even what looks to be some sort of capsule vending machine.
